Join host Jason Harmon and co-host Amy Spencer as they travel to Brownsville, Tennessee, for an inspiring episode inside a trophy room filled with stories of grit, family, and the great outdoors. Our featured guest, 13-year-old Clayton Pinner, isn’t your average hunter—he’s harvested an incredible 61 deer, the most of any 13-year-old in Tennessee! But Clayton’s story goes far beyond hunting success. After overcoming a rare form of cancer at a young age, Clayton has shown remarkable determination to return to the woods and live life to the fullest.In this episode, you’ll hear how Clayton started hunting at just two years old, his favorite traditions with his dad, David, and grandpa “Gopher,” and the unforgettable hunts that shaped his journey—including the story behind his milestone 60th deer. We’ll also dive into family traditions, favorite hunting snacks (spoiler: Little Debbie Christmas Tree Cakes and milkshakes!), and how homework sometimes makes its way to the deer blind.Clayton’s mom, Natalie, joins the conversation to share how the outdoors played a vital role in his recovery and how St. Jude’s incredible team supported his love for hunting throughout treatment. From overcoming obstacles to setting new goals, Clayton’s story is a testament to perseverance, family bonds, and passing on the hunting tradition.Whether you’re a seasoned outdoorsman or simply love a good story of resilience, this episode will leave you inspired. Tune in to hear how Clayton’s motto—“Take the T off Can’t”—guides his life and why he’s ready to share the outdoors with friends who’ve never had the chance to hunt.
